Set a Custom Ringtone auf OnePlus
OxygenOS only lists ringtones it can find in specific storage locations. A personal mp3 file has to sit in the correct folder before it shows up as a selectable option, which is why copying a track onto the phone is not enough on its own.
Open Settings ➔ Sounds & vibration ➔ Phone ringtone and vibration. On a Dual SIM device you will also see Enable or disable Set ringtone for each SIM card (Dual SIM). Turn this on if SIM 1 and SIM 2 should use different sounds, then pick Choose SIM card 1 / 2 for the one you want to change.
Tap Ringtone from internal storage and select Choose a custom ringtone to browse the audio files stored on the device. Only files placed in a location the system audio picker can access will appear here.
If the toggle for separate SIM ringtones stays off, the phone applies one ringtone to both SIM slots. Switching it on later does not delete existing tones, it only unlocks a second selection field for the additional SIM.
A custom ringtone set through this menu applies to calls only. Notification sounds are configured separately, so a track chosen here will not automatically play for messages or app alerts.
